Output d66c58bafdaa8c7bee1cdb6931bb991ad3ef8dd8a10c9d91aaf8365d6f48c280:0

value
14803559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f358eb9179a00dded67902e10076a4238ac1e52d OP_EQUAL
address
3PsieSZej46PTfZwqsFR3fUGCNeEzANZtk
transaction
d66c58bafdaa8c7bee1cdb6931bb991ad3ef8dd8a10c9d91aaf8365d6f48c280
spent
true